/workspace/src/extensions/PageAssessments
src
(Dashboard)
Classes
Coverage Distribution
Complexity
Insufficient Coverage
Class
Coverage
MediaWiki\Extension\PageAssessments\Api\ApiQueryPageAssessments
0%
MediaWiki\Extension\PageAssessments\Api\ApiQueryProjectPages
0%
MediaWiki\Extension\PageAssessments\Api\ApiQueryProjects
0%
MediaWiki\Extension\PageAssessments\Hooks
0%
MediaWiki\Extension\PageAssessments\NamespaceSelect
0%
MediaWiki\Extension\PageAssessments\SchemaHooks
0%
MediaWiki\Extension\PageAssessments\SpecialPage
0%
MediaWiki\Extension\PageAssessments\PageAssessmentsDAO
34%
Project Risks
Class
CRAP
MediaWiki\Extension\PageAssessments\SpecialPage
1332
MediaWiki\Extension\PageAssessments\Api\ApiQueryProjectPages
870
MediaWiki\Extension\PageAssessments\PageAssessmentsDAO
552
MediaWiki\Extension\PageAssessments\Api\ApiQueryPageAssessments
342
MediaWiki\Extension\PageAssessments\Api\ApiQueryProjects
132
MediaWiki\Extension\PageAssessments\Hooks
90
MediaWiki\Extension\PageAssessments\SchemaHooks
6
Methods
Coverage Distribution
Complexity
Insufficient Coverage
Method
Coverage
__construct
0%
__construct
0%
getInputOOUI
0%
doUpdates
0%
getProjectName
0%
extractParentProjectId
0%
getProjectId
0%
insertProject
0%
deleteRecordsForPage
0%
cacheAssessment
0%
onLoadExtensionSchemaUpdates
0%
getGroupName
0%
onLinksUpdateComplete
0%
getDescription
0%
getQueryInfo
0%
outputResults
0%
getTableHeader
0%
linkParameters
0%
formatResult
0%
execute
0%
getOrderFields
0%
sortDescending
0%
onArticleDeleteComplete
0%
onParserFirstCallInit
0%
execute
0%
buildDbQuery
0%
buildDbQuery
0%
handleQueryContinuation
0%
getAllowedParams
0%
getExamplesMessages
0%
getHelpUrls
0%
__construct
0%
execute
0%
executeGenerator
0%
run
0%
handleQueryContinuation
0%
getHelpUrls
0%
generateResultVals
0%
getAllowedParams
0%
getExamplesMessages
0%
getHelpUrls
0%
__construct
0%
getCacheMode
0%
execute
0%
getAllowedParams
0%
getExamplesMessages
0%
getForm
0%
Project Risks
Method
CRAP
doUpdates
380
run
132
buildDbQuery
72
getForm
56
onLinksUpdateComplete
56
execute
42
execute
42
getQueryInfo
30
getTableHeader
30
buildDbQuery
30
execute
20
linkParameters
12
outputResults
12
getProjectName
12
extractParentProjectId
12
generateResultVals
12
insertProject
6
getAllowedParams
6
onLoadExtensionSchemaUpdates
6
getExamplesMessages
6
getExamplesMessages
6
getAllowedParams
6
getOrderFields
6
cacheAssessment
6